Residential landscaping services encompass a wide range of projects aimed at enhancing the appearance, functionality, and value of a home's outdoor space. These services typically include designing and installing lawns, planting trees and shrubs, laying down pathways, and creating outdoor features such as patios, decks, or garden beds. Skilled service providers work closely with homeowners to develop customized plans that reflect personal preferences and complement the property's architecture, ensuring a harmonious and inviting outdoor environment.
Many homeowners seek residential landscaping to address common problems such as uneven or overgrown yards, poor drainage, or lack of privacy. Overgrown vegetation can obscure the home's exterior and reduce curb appeal, while poorly planned landscapes may lead to drainage issues or maintenance challenges. Professional landscapers can help resolve these issues by reshaping the terrain, installing proper drainage solutions, and creating organized planting schemes that require less upkeep. These improvements not only enhance curb appeal but can also make outdoor spaces safer and more enjoyable.

The overview below groups typical Residential Landscaping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or landscaping fixes like planting new flowers or fixing a small lawn area usually range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end for more extensive work.
Mid-Size Projects - larger tasks such as installing new sprinkler systems or adding garden features often c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to enhance their outdoor spaces without a full overhaul.
Full Landscape Installations - comprehensive landscaping, including grading, planting, and hardscape features, typically ranges from $4,000 to $10,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, depending on scope and materials.
Complete Yard Renovations - extensive overhauls that involve redesigning entire yards can start around $15,000 and may go well beyond $50,000. Such projects are less frequent but create significant transformations for properties seeking a major upgrade.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a residential landscaping service provider, it is important to consider their experience with projects similar to the one at hand. Homeowners should inquire about the types of landscaping projects the local contractors have completed and whether they have worked on properties with comparable size, style, or scope. An experienced service provider will have a better understanding of what works well in the local climate and terrain, which can help ensure the final result meets expectations and withstands seasonal changes.
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th working relationship. Homeowners should seek out local pros who can provide detailed descriptions of their services, including the scope of work, materials used, and any specific steps involved in the project.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the project’s goals. It’s also beneficial to discuss the process for handling changes or unforeseen issues that may arise during the project.
Reputable references and good communication are key indicators of a dependable service provider. Homeowners can ask local contractors for references from past clients with similar projects to gain insight into their work quality and professionalism. Additionally, responsive and clear communication throughout the process can make a significant difference in the overall experience. Service providers who are transparent, attentive, and willing to address questions or concerns tend to foster a more positive working relationship and help ensure the project proceeds smoothly.
